Ir para conteúdo
  • Cadastre-se

dev botao

  • Este tópico foi criado há 1857 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Postado

Boa tarde amigos, tudo bem? 

Sou novo na comunidade, gostaria de agradecer por este grande projeto. Podem me ajudar com uma dúvida, por favor? Desculpem se este não é o local certo para este tipo de dúvida, mas não achei outro que se enquadrasse melhor. 

Tenho um pequeno comércio e estou desenvolvendo meu próprio ERP com PDV. Sempre noto que para emitir cupons fiscais via SAT (estou em SP) se faz necessário informar o CNPJ da software house e sua assinatura. Porém, neste caso não há software house envolvida. Como devo proceder nesse caso?

Outra coisa: estou desenvolvendo o sistema em PHP, o mesmo vai rodar em um servidor Web (HostGator) em Linux. O AcbrMonitor precisa ser instalado localmente (no computador caixa, onde estão o SAT e a impressora) ou no servidor da HostGator? 

Gostaria de poder testar o AcbrMonitor antes de me associar ao projeto, para poder justificar o investimento. 

Podem me ajudar, por favor?

Muito obrigado! 

  • Fundadores
Postado

Não creio que seja um bom cenário de uso... a aplicação PHP precisaria acessar por Socket o ACBrMonitorPLUS, rodando na máquina local... não faz muito sentido (nem é muito simples) um Servidor Web tentar acessar um IP de uma máquina Local

Consultor SAC ACBr

Daniel Simões de Almeida
O melhor TEF, é com o Projeto ACBr - Clique e Conheça
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r     Telefone:(15) 2105-0750 WhatsApp(15)99790-2976.

Postado

Olá Daniel, tudo bem? Agradeço pela ajuda! 

Será que via arquivos TXT não seria possível?

Além dessa possibilidade, o que você sugere? 

Obrigado mais uma vez! 

  • Fundadores
Postado

Por TXT acho que seria ainda mais complicado... Afinal como uma aplicação rodando em um Servidor Web poderia escrever em um HD de uma máquina local ??

5 minutos atrás, wendelmsilva disse:

Outra coisa, independentemente da questão técnica, como devo proceder em relação à software house? 

Não compreendi a sua pergunta...

Consultor SAC ACBr

Daniel Simões de Almeida
O melhor TEF, é com o Projeto ACBr - Clique e Conheça
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r     Telefone:(15) 2105-0750 WhatsApp(15)99790-2976.

Postado
6 minutos atrás, Daniel Simoes disse:

Por TXT acho que seria ainda mais complicado... Afinal como uma aplicação rodando em um Servidor Web poderia escrever em um HD de uma máquina local ??

Não compreendi a sua pergunta...

Para TXT pensei em usar Javascript. Ou você acha melhor instalar no servidor? O problema do servidor é que o SAT está local. Desculpe se estou falando besteira, é que comecei agora a mexer nisso, estou estudando muito por aqui. 

Quanto à software house, é o seguinte: Tenho um pequeno comércio e estou desenvolvendo meu próprio ERP com PDV. Sempre noto que para emitir cupons fiscais via SAT (estou em SP) se faz necessário informar o CNPJ da software house e sua assinatura. Porém, neste caso não há software house envolvida. Como devo proceder nesse caso?

Postado

Essa de produtor de software próprio eu não conhecia, vou falar com o meu contador. 

Sem querer abusar, mas você acha que vale a pena ir pelo caminho do Javascript? Estou pensando em algo como o Market Up (guardadas as devidas proporções, rsrsrs). 

Obrigado de novo! 

  • Fundadores
Postado

Sendo bem sincero.. PHP / Web não parece ser uma boa alternativa para um sistema de Frente de Caixa...  pois esses sistemas exigem funcionamento, mesmo quando desconectado da Rede ou BD...

Se isso não for um impedimento para o seu comercio...  eu recomendaria ainda assim, usar Sockets, e não TXTs

 

Consultor SAC ACBr

Daniel Simões de Almeida
O melhor TEF, é com o Projeto ACBr - Clique e Conheça
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r     Telefone:(15) 2105-0750 WhatsApp(15)99790-2976.

  • 2 semanas depois ...
Postado

Para funcionar da maneira que você pretende você até pode usar o PHP para criar sua aplicação, porém toda comunicação com o ACBrMonitorPLUS deverá ser feita via Javascript já que apenas ele terá acesso (limitado) a maquina do usuário.

O problema aqui é que não encontrei uma forma de se comunicar via Socket TCP com javascript pelo browser. Talvez seja necessário criar um aplicativo (nos moldes no Market UP) que cria um servidor web local para fazer essa interconexão entre seu aplicativo e o ACBrMonitorPLUS.

Como o Daniel citou, o PDV deve funcionar independente da conexão com a internet o que reforça a necessidade por um aplicativo que funcione 100% offline. Para isso você pode usar uma biblioteca para armazenamento de dados local e apenas enviar os dados das transações para seu servidor (Aplicação PHP) quando houver acesso a internet.

 

 

 

 

 

 

 

  • Curtir 3
  • Este tópico foi criado há 1857 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.

The popup will be closed in 10 segundos...